(68) MY WISH TONIGHT
I wish so much...
That you were here with me tonight,
Actually here in my house,
With me at this moment.
I wish I could get up from this chair
And walk into the bedroom
And find you there in my bed...
With your outstretched arms
Inviting me to join you.
I wish I could feel...
The warmth from your body
On my sheets and my pillow
Instead of the coldness that awaits me
Under those sad, empty covers.
I wish I could melt into your warm arms
And merge and become one with you,
Knowing at last...
That I've found the lost other half of me.
